At 13:34 hours IST, the Nifty was trading with positive bias & was inching towards the 4900 mark. Heavy buying was seen in banking, metal, oil & gas and FMCG stocks. On the losing side, telecom stocks continued to reel under pressure. About one percent rise in European markets was also supportive.

 

All BSE sectoral indices were trading in green barring TECk Index. The BSE Midcap and Smallcap indices gained 1.24% and 1.83%, respectively. Out of 30 stocks in Sensex, 26 stocks were trading in green. Reliance, Infosys, ICICI Bank, L&T, ITC, SBI and HDFC were the positive contributors for the Sensex.

 

The Sensex was up 241.13 points or 1.49% at 16399.41, and the Nifty was up 81.40 points or 1.70% at 4877.55. About 2078 shares advanced while 902 shares declined. Nearly 786 shares were unchanged. On the F&O side, huge activity of put writing was seen in 4700 and 4600 puts. 

 

Top gainers on the Sensex were Reliance at Rs 2,021.35, up 3.30%; ITC at Rs 256.50, up 3.20%; Tata Power at Rs 1,310.20, up 3.04%; ICICI Bank at Rs 871.55, up 2.69% and SBI at Rs 2,261.65, up 2.61%.

 

Cigarette major ITC was trading at Rs 256.50 up 3.2% from its previous close of Rs 248.55.

 

Top losers on the Sensex were Bharti Airtel at Rs 308.75, down 3.49%; Reliance Communications at Rs 174.05, down 2.22%; HUL at Rs 271.10, down 0.7% and BHEL at Rs 2,220, down 0.07%.

 

Most active shares on NSE were Reliance, SBI, ICICI Bank, Unitech and HDIL.

 

Top gainers on the BSE Midcap - Jai Corp, Central Bank, Sobha Developer, Thomas Cook and Hotel Leela were up 6-20%.

 

Top gainers on the BSE Smallcap - Orbit Corporation, Gulf Oil Corp, KPIT Cummins, Kalyani Steels and IVR Prime were up 9-15%.
